More about the book
Focusing on the unsustainable nature of fossil energy, the book explores hydrogen as a viable alternative. It details how computer modeling assesses hydrogen capacity and its environmental implications. The text also examines the financial and technical hurdles necessary for large-scale commercial adoption, potential development barriers, and the crucial role of ongoing government support. Additionally, it presents long-term hydrogen usage projections utilizing the Monte Carlo method, highlighting the need for strategic planning in energy transition.
